Share Account means the brokerage account established by the Agent for each Participant to which shares of Common Stock purchased under the Plan are credited in accordance with Section 9. The Share Account will be established pursuant to a separate agreement between each Participant and the Agent.

Share Account means an account established for a member for which no share certificates are issued but which are included in the registry of shares, which includes all transactions of the credit union pertaining to such shares.

Share Account means the account created by the Company pursuant to Article III of this Plan in accordance with an election by a Director to defer Fees and receive share-related compensation under Article II hereof.
Share Account means an account established for each Participant who exercises a Right to Purchase under Section 10. A Participant's Share Account will be credited with the number of Shares purchased on each Right to Purchase Date and debited for the number of Shares withdrawn by the Participant after such date.
Share Account means the bookkeeping account established by the Company for the deferrals of Fees by Directors, which will be credited with Share Units pursuant to Section 6(a) hereof.
